Job Duties
- Load and unload installer's trucks
- Perform a variety of warehouse duties including pulling and assembling customer orders, checking outbound orders for accuracy, inventory stock checks, restocking and labeling vendor products, maintaining displays, moving, storing, and replenishing materials, and conducting daily cycle counts
- Perform receiving duties such as receiving and unloading inbound material, processing inbound shipments, stocking material, processing customer returns, and notifying management of damaged shipments for freight claims
- Maintain, clean, and organize the facility by sweeping and trash removal
- Receive and inspect incoming material orders from approved vendors
- Cycle count inventory, store items in an orderly and accessible manner, inspect stock items for wear or defects, and report to supervision
- Ensure loads are complete and secured to minimize damage and breakage
- Make occasional deliveries to job sites or customers
- Perform any other duties as assigned
